> The short answer is you can't. It's a pity, but to the present day the
> vanilla Ocaml distribution does not support mixing native and byte-code.
> Also, it is not possibile to Dynlink native code, which is even more of
> a pity.
Well, dynlink with native code probably isn't desirable, as can't
really verify it.
How about embedding the bytecode interpreter in an ocaml native
program? How would one go about that?
